…zard trigger If a user has Claude Code installed but never configured Hermes, the first-run guard found those external credentials and skipped the setup wizard. Users got silently routed to someone else's inference without being asked. Now _has_any_provider_configured() checks whether Hermes itself has been explicitly configured (model in config differs from hardcoded default) before counting Claude Code credentials. Fresh installs trigger the wizard regardless of what external tools are on the machine. Salvaged from PR #4194 by sudoingX — wizard trigger fix only. Model auto-detect change under separate review.

Custom endpoint setup (_model_flow_custom) now probes the server first and presents detected models instead of asking users to type blind: - Single model: auto-confirms with Y/n prompt - Multiple models: numbered list picker, or type a name - No models / probe failed: falls back to manual input Context length prompt also moved after model selection so the user sees the verified endpoint before being asked for details. All recent fixes preserved: config dict sync (#4172), api_key persistence (#4182), no save_env_value for URLs (#4165). Inspired by PR #4194 by sudoingX — re-implemented against current main.

if a user has claude code or codex cli installed but has never configured hermes, the first-run guard finds those external credentials and skips the setup wizard. the user gets silently routed to someone else's inference without being asked.
the fix checks whether hermes itself has been configured before looking at external credentials. if the model in config is empty or still the default, the wizard triggers regardless of what else is on the machine.
separately, the custom endpoint setup probes the server and knows what models are available but still asks the user to type the name manually. now it auto-selects if one model is found, shows a numbered list if multiple, and falls back to manual input if the server is unreachable.
tested on a fresh gpu node with llama.cpp serving a model and on a local machine with claude code installed and no server running.
